Shovel hydraulic system
Excavator hydraulic system is one of the main and very important components of the excavator, which is used to transmit mechanical power and control the movements of the excavator. This system uses hydraulic oil as a working material, which is injected into the system by a hydraulic pump.
Excavator hydraulic system consists of several parts and parts that coordinate with each other. These parts include oil tank, hydraulic pump, cylinders, valves, pipes and connections. Each part has its own task in the system.
The main task of the hydraulic system of the excavator is to transmit mechanical power. Using a hydraulic pump, hydraulic oil is injected from the tank into the system and transferred to the various parts of the excavator by cylinders. This oil is put under pressure and causes the movement of parts such as the arm, the drilling machine and other parts of the shovel.
The hydraulic system of the excavator has a powerful ability. This system provides the necessary power and control to perform heavy and precise tasks in the shovel. Also, the hydraulic system of the excavator can be easily controlled and adjusted and allows changing the speed and power of movement.
Overall, the hydraulic system of the excavator is one of the vital components of the excavator, which is very important for the correct and efficient operation of the excavator.
What is the Suspension Suspension?
Excavator suspension system is one of the important components of the shovel, which is used to absorb shocks and vibrations and reduce the effects caused by the movement of the shovel during operation. This system is able to absorb the shocks and vibrations caused by unwanted movements of the shovel and reduces the vibrations and negative effects on the performance and comfort of the employees.
Excavator suspension system usually consists of several parts and parts that interact with each other.
These parts include chain suspension system, wheel suspension system and cabin frame suspension system.
- Chain suspension system: Excavator chains, which are used to maintain balance and reduce vibrations and shocks, can have rubber corners or special suspension systems. These parts are usually placed at the contact points of the chains with the shovel structures and absorb the effects of vibration and shocks.
- Wheel suspension system: Some mechanical excavators have wheels that are used to transport the excavator and facilitate its movement. Wheel suspension system using springs, hydraulic suspension or other suspension systems, reduces the effects of vibrations and shocks and increases the comfort of shovel movement.
- Cabin frame suspension system: Excavator cabin is one of the vital parts of the excavator that protects the workers against vibrations and shocks. The cabin frame suspension system absorbs vibrations and shocks by using springs, hydraulic suspension or other suspension systems and reduces the negative effects on employees.
By using the excavator suspension system, the vibrations and shocks caused by the movement of the excavator are minimized, improving the comfort and safety of the workers. This system helps the correct and efficient operation of the shovel and can also increase the useful life of the shovel.
